1. The Post Ranch Inn, Big Sur, CA.
For being above the clouds (feels like living in an airplane), the setting, the architecture and the crazy level of service.
2. Grand Hôtel, Stockholm, Sweden.
For the fantastic new spa, the view of the Royal Castle and the extremely professional yet friendly staff.
3. Ngorongoro Crater Lodge, Tanzania.
It's constantly rated in the very top of all surveys for location. There's a reason for that. Your own personal butler and the superb staff adds up to it. And then I haven't even mentioned that you'll get some of the world's most outstanding game viewing on the crater floor a few hundred meters below.

| CMH Bugaboo Lodge. It's not so much about the lodge, although it is wonderful. It's about the seclusion, the comraderie and the scenery and feeling of being a magical place. It's helicopter access only, accommodates only 44 people and sits below the majestic Bugaboo Spires. It's a place that puts everything in perspective. Oh, and I forgot to mention the gourmet cuisine, the stellar wine list, the roof-top hot tub with the view of the surrounding peaks, the heated floors in the bathroom, the cozy down-duvets, the fireplace in the living room....ahh, it is a magical place. The staff are exceptional and you feel like you are at home from the moment you walk in the door. it's the kind of place where you leave your camera on the coffee table in the entrance way and know it will be there 3 hrs later. That is a luxury. |
